1. The anti-nutrient is Phytic acid. Cooking oats will reduce this. Nobody just munches on raw un-milled oats straight from the ground.
https://www.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/pmc/articles/PMC4325021/
2. Eating any carb elicits a glucose spike, a glucose spike by itself isn't bad unless you're diabetic. Regardless, as far as carbs are concerned whole grains like oats actually show a reduced glucose response post meal.
https://www.sciencedirect.com/science/article/pii/S002231662200044X
3. Oats have plenty of fiber in comparison to other grains and refined carbs. It's effects on satiety and the benefits of fiber are well researched and documented.
https://www.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/pmc/articles/PMC4757923/
4. Nobody recommends eating oats to meet your daily protein needs. An egg in comparison to any carb will have more protein, his point is idiotic.
While oats contain anti-nutrients, they also contain minerals which are less affected by anti-nutrients. Like, potassium which is easily absorbed, while iron and zinc might be more affected.
And If you add anything else to it or eat along, it gives enough minerals.
And also if you soak oats for sprouts or ferment it like the Dosa batter, it can reduce anti-nutrient content.

Actually chicken only contains 1gm of protein, if you don't mention per how many grams total.
Oats have 12-14gm protein per 100gm, and as far as cereals go, that's pretty good.
In fact, the ICMR recommends getting 25gm protein a day from cereals only.
Sure, it contains carbs which spike blood sugar. But that's normal? Unless you have insulin issues, eat carbs for quick energy. Of course, avoid eating sweet things, but avoiding oats for this reason is nuts unless you're diabetic.

Bhai woh chhodo wtf are anti-nutrients?
Things like phytic acid that bind to minerals/nutrients in a way that prevents it from getting absorbed and assimilated
Thanks! Do you know if they have advantages of their own at all?
Some antinutrients have little antioxidant property, other than that probably no other advantage
